Busse Lake
April 23, 2024
Busse Lake, located in Cook County, Illinois, is a popular fishing destination for anglers of all skill levels. The lake is home to several fish species, including largemouth bass, bluegill, crappie, catfish, and northern pike. In addition to fishing, visitors can also enjoy hiking, biking, and birdwatching in the surrounding area. To increase your chances of catching fish, it's recommended to use live bait and fish in the early morning or late afternoon hours. The best time to visit is during the spring and fall months when the weather is mild, with average temperatures ranging from 50-70°F.
